
Aim: The aim of the projeck is to integrate early neurorehabilitation into the healthcare system for patients with acquired severe brain injury in the Czech Republic.Objectives. Methods: The intensive neurorehabilitation (NINR) pilot project implements phase B1 of the neurorehabilitation phase model, which is defined as the early rehabilitation phase. During this phase, intensive care must be provided if necessary, including the possibility of artificial pulmonary ventilation. Patients indicated for admission to the NINR facility are conditiontransferred from intensive or acute neurosurgical care units, such as traumatic brain injury, inflammatory brain dis ease, brain tumor, cerebral stroke or impaired cerebrospinal fluid production, flow and resorption. Admission is possible within one month of the onset of the condition, according to admission criteria. The maximum duration of care provided to one patient at NINR facility is 12 weeks. If necessary, the length of stay at an NINR facility can be prolonged due to a deferred prognosis; in such cases, an ,indication seminar` is held with representatives of the health insurance company in attendance, where justification for such a proposal is assessed and further actions are recommended. A stay at the NINR facility will end if there has been no improvement for an uninterrupted period of up to six weeks, or ifa Barthel Index value of 30 has been achieved at anytime during the stay. Under the NINR program, patients receive up to 12 weeks of 3 to 4 h of intensive therapy per day. Results: The project is currently operating at three locations in the Czech Republic. As of the end of June 2025, early neurorehabilitation as part of the project had been completed in 122 patients, who were admitted on average 18 days after the onset of acute illness. The average hospitalization time at NINR facility was 45.8 days. Upon admission, 53.6% of patients were on mechanical ventilation, compared to 9.7% at discharge. Of those admitted with tracheostomy (79.5%), 29.5% remained upon discharge. A Barthel Index score of 30 or more was achieved by 75 (61.5%) patients at discharge. 38% were able to progress to the next phase of rehabilitation, 30% were transferred to fol lowor longintensive care units, and 11%were released to home care. Conclusion:The project results demonstrate the feasibility of successfully implementing this approach into the healthcare system in the Czech Republic. Following the completion of the project, we hope to extend this care to other facilities.
Introduction: Herniated disc is a common cause of lumbar radiculopathy. Full endoscopic discectomy is a minimally invasive alternative to microdiscectomy. The aim of the study was to evaluate the results and complications of endoscopic procedures and to compare the transforaminal and interlaminar approaches. Methods: A retrospective analysis included 64 patients (40 men, 24 women; mean age 51.2 years). Transforaminal approach was performed in 12 patients and interlaminar in 52 patients. In both groups, we evaluated the duration of surgery, X-ray exposure, Visual Analogue Scale (VAS) and Oswestry Disability Index (ODI) (before the procedure, at discharge, 3 and 12 months after surgery), postoperative complications, and the frequency of postoperative recurrence of herniated disc. Results: The mean duration of surgery was 62 min. X-ray exposure was longer with the transforaminal approach (43 s) than with the interlaminar approach (22 s; P < 0.001). VAS decreased from 7.4 +/- 1.2 to 1.3 +/- 0.8 at 12 months (P < 0.0001), and ODI from 56% +/- 13% to 14% +/- 9% (P < 0.0001). No significant difference was found between the transforaminal and translaminar approaches in VAS and ODI. The results are valid for the entire group of patients. The overall complication rate was 14.0%. We recorded dural sac injuries twice (3.1%) without the need for surgical revision. Recurrence of disc herniation was recorded in 7 patients (10.9%). Conclusion: Transforaminal and translaminar endoscopic extirpation of intervertebral disc herniation is an effective and safe method with rapid recovery and low morbidity. The translaminar approach is suitable for centrolateral herniations, where it allows a more direct and anatomically clearer approach to the pathology with better control of the dural sac and nerve root and is associated with lower technical demands. The transforaminal approach is used for medial and laterally localized intervertebral disc herniations. The advantage is the preservation of the integrity of the spinal canal with minimal manipulation of the dural sac. However, it is technically more demanding and the result depends on the experience of the surgeon.
Academician Kamil Henner ranks among the most prominent figures in 20th-century Czechoslovakian neurology.This article outlines not only his exceptional professional contributions, but also the key milestones of his life and his personality. Henner began his career at the First Department of Internal Medicine under Ladislav Syllaba, where he gradually established himself as a neurologist and built his own school of disciples. In 1937, he became the head of the Neurology Department at the General Hospital, but his early tenure was significantly affected by the events of World War II, during which Henner and his colleagues became actively involved in the resistance. After World War II, Henner succeeded in transforming the department into a leading center for neurology. Henner's scientific work was remarkably broad and productive; he authored more than 300 publications. His pedagogical influence was equally important-both at the undergraduate level, where he improved the quality of neurological education, and at the postgraduate level, where he trained an entire generation of neurologists, many of whom later achieved the highest academic positions. His death marked the end of an era in Czechoslovakian neurology.
Background: Parkinson's disease is a neurodegenerative disorder that not only affects motor functions, but also speech and voice production. Music therapy represents a promising non-pharmacological approach to support communication in this population. Objectives: This interventional studyaimed to evaluate the impact ofan original structured music therapy program on speech intelligibility, voice quality, and spontaneous speech production in individuals with Parkinson's disease. Methods: Study participants (N = 17) participated in an eight-week structured group program focused on voice, breathing, articulation, and singing. Pre-and post-intervention assessments included the GRBAS scale, a speech intelligibility test, and the Analysis ofSpontaneous Speech (ASpoR) tool to evaluate spontaneous speech. Data were analyzed statistically using descriptive and inferential methods with effect size calculation. Results: Participants demonstrated consistent improvement in overall speech intelligibility, with a significant gain in the combined score (P = 0.0099, d = 0.71). GRBAS scores improved descriptively, though not significantly, with large effect sizes for breathiness (r = 0.83) and strain (r = 0.67). While fluency and error rates in spontaneous speech showed no significant change, the intervention significantly enhanced self-monitoring, as evidenced by a higher percentage of corrected errors relative to total errors (P = 0.00097, r = 0.87), and a reduced ratio of uncorrected to corrected errors (P = 0.00049, r = 0.87). Conclusion: The program improved several aspects of communication, suggesting the therapeutic potential of music therapy for this population.
Backgroundandobjective:Although intravenous thrombolysis(IVT) isa recommended recanalization therapy for ischemic stroke, it is associated with a risk of symptomatic intracranial hemorrhage. This academic clinical study aims to evaluate the relationship between fibrinogen levels and their drop measured at 6 and 24 h after IVT and the risk of intracranial hemorrhage, specifically parenchymal hematoma, which is the most clinically significant type of intracranial hemorrhage. Methods: Seven primary stroke centers and comprehensive stroke centers in the Czech Republic will be involved in the multicenter retrospective study. The estimated total number of patients enrolled in the observation and control groups is 300, with defined entry parameters maintained. The parameters monitored include personal and pharmacological history, laboratory parameters, neurological findings, and imaging results. Results: The study will evaluate the degree of association between fibrinogen levels and their drop measured at 6 and 24 h after IVT and the risk of parenchymal hematoma. Conclusion: Evidence of an association between the development of parenchymal hematoma and a decrease in fibrinogen levels in patients with ischemic stroke treated with IVT may be used to design an interventional study with fibrinogen replacement to prevent bleeding.
Aim: This article explores brain death assessment according to neurological criteria and evaluates a nationwide survey on diagnostic procedures. It also examines awareness among healthcare professionals. Methods: An online survey was conducted from January 7 to March 3, 2025, targeting 115 healthcare facilities. The questionnaire collected demographic data, specialties, and frequency of brain death assessments and examination of individual reflexes. Results: 523 respondents participated in the questionnaire survey, with 38% having experience in brain death assessment. A total of 187 physicians regularly examine brain death, with 74% of them performing fewer than five examinations per year. The most common specialists were anesthesiologists (48%) and neurologists (27%). Most physicians (50%) follow the IKEM "& Zcaron;ivot2" manual. The main reason for the examination (61%) was the donor program. The apnea test is performed by 81% of respondents, 90% of them only after a clinical examination. The most commonly used confirmatory method is CTA (26%), while 43% of physicians indicate confirmatory testing only in the case of a donor program. Conclusion: A questionnaire survey revealed the existence of interindividual differences in the investigative procedure for clinical determination of brain death in the Czech Republic. The consistency of clinical examinations is insufficient in patients referred to the donor program. In contrast, the apnea test is unnecessarily overused in examinations conducted as part of the decision-making process regarding futile care limitations. The findings emphasize the need for enhanced education on brain death assessment, particularly those who rarely encounter this diagnosis. It is also crucial to understand the concept of brain death and how it is communicated both among healthcare professionals and to the public.
Ladislav Haskovec was the central founding figure in the field of neurology in the Czech lands. For three decades, he advocated the recognition of neurology as an independent teaching and clinical discipline; however, it was not until 1926 that he succeeded in establishing the "University Department for Nervous Diseases" at the Faculty of Medicine of Charles University. He was then granted only ten years to lead the department. A persistent motive of his career was not merely the scientific development of the field, but also a sustained struggle for beds, outpatient facilities, laboratories, and personnel-in other words, for the "infrastructure" of the discipline. The article tracesHaskovec 's professional trajectory from his habilitation in neuropathology in 1896, through the establishment of the first neurological outpatient clinic and ward at Na Franti & scaron;ku Hospital, to the institutional consolidation of the department in the former monastery at Karlov. Drawing on archival sources, it analyses the circumstances of its foundation, its staffing conditions, and the role of Haskovec `s collaborators and pupils. The study also addresses the question of his priority among habilitated neurologists in the Czech lands and situates his work within the broader Central European context of the emergence of modern neurology.
Objective: The study compares the health status of pediatric patients after prenatal and postnatal surgical treatment of open neural tube defects in order to determine the success of the above approaches in the treatment of patients. Methods: The retrospective study analyzes the health status of 12 prenatally and 17 postnatally operated patients between 2016 and 2024. Fetal procedures were performed at the Spina Bifida Center at the Children's Hospital in Z & uuml;rich, Switzerland, and postnatal surgeries were performed at National Institute of Childrens Diseases in Bratislava, Slovakia. Results: We recorded the following values in prenatally and postnatally operated patients-the incidence of shunt-dependent hydrocephalus was 33.33% and 47.06%; psychomotor development was slowed down in 25% and 23.53%;41.67%and 52.94%were able to walk independently, or walk independently with orthopedic aids; neurogenic bladder was present in 66.67% and 58.88%; and neurogenic obstipation was found in 41.67% and 41.18% of patients, respectively. Arnold-Chiari malformation type II occured in 91.67%of patients after prenatal surgery and in 100% of patients after postnatal surgery. Conclusion: We consider prenatal correction of open neural tube defects to be effective and beneficial due to the lower rate of need for surgical interventions for hydrocephalus and the lower number of children whose mobility depends on another person or a wheelchair.
Spontaneous intracerebral hemorrhage (SICH) represents a significant subtype of acute stroke with high morbidity and mortality. Comprehensive SICH management aims to increase survival rates and improve clinical outcomes of patients with this disease. The guidelines cover the areas of care organization, diagnosis, medical treatment (acute blood pressure lowering and hemostatic treatment), surgical treatment, prevention and treatment of complications, secondary prevention, prediction of the final clinical condition and care goals, rehabilitation and neurobehavioral complications, quality control, and discharge report requirements. The presented guidelines for the management of SICH in adult patients represent a consensus opinion of the committees of the Czech Neurological Society of the Czech Medical Association JEP, and the Czech Neurosurgical Society of the Czech Medical Association JEP.
Objective: The aim of this study was to translate and validate the psychometric properties of the Patterns of Activity Measure-Pain in the Czech language. This tool assesses behavioral patterns related to physical activity in patients with chronic pain. As no validated instrument of this kind currently exists in the Czech context, the adaptation of the assessment tool represents an important contribution to diagnostic assessment and the individualization of therapeutic interventions in this population. Methods: A total of 151 patients (18-65 years) with chronic low back pain were included in the study. The instrument was linguistically adapted following international guidelines. Subsequently, exploratory and confirmatory factor analyses were conducted. Internal consistency was evaluated using Cronbach's alpha, and convergent and concurrent validity were assessed through correlations with other validated instruments. Results: A three-factor structure of the tool (avoidance, overdoing, and activity pacing) was confirmed. The final confirmatory factor analysis model, after removing three items, showed an acceptable model fit. Internal consistency for the domains ranged from 0.89 to 0.94. Convergent and concurrent validity were supported by correlations with pain intensity, quality of life, psychological distress, and physical activity level. Conclusions: The Czech version of the Patterns of Activity Measure-Pain demonstrates good psychometric properties and can be considered as a reliable instrument for both clinical and research use in assessing activity-related behavioral patterns in patients with chronic low back pain.

Introduction: Sexual dysfunction (SD) is a common, but often underestimated and inadequately addressed symptom in men and women with MS.The prevalence ofSD has not been systematically described in Czech MS patients, and therefore our aim was to map the prevalence of SD in women with MS, including possible associated factors. Methods: The standardized questionnaire Female Sexual Function Index (FSFI) was used to assess SD. The FSFI questionnaire was distributed in a long-term prospective study (monitoring disease course and symptoms) to a total of 251 women with MS (mean age of patients was 43.3 +/- 8.9 years; with a mean disease duration of 14.7 +/- 6.2 years). Results: The complete questionnaire was completed by 147 women (response rate 58.5%). A total of 48 respondents (32.6%) were identified as having SD. When compared with the rate of neurological disability, a weak to moderate negative correlation was found with the total Expanded Disability Status Scale score (0.481; P = 0.002). Patients with SD were older (P = 0.001), with a longer disease duration (P = 0.012) and higher rates of neurological disability (P = 0.001). Conclusion: Sexual dysfunction in women with MS seems to be mainly associated with sensory dysfunction. It was also more prevalent in older women with longer disease duration. Therefore, it is recommended for the clinical practice to ask specifically about the possible occurrence of SD especially in women with sensory symptoms.
Background: Stroke is the second most common cause of death in the Czech Republic. Ischemic stroke accounts for more than 3 of all strokes. In 2020, the incidence of ischemic stroke was 211 cases per 100,000 people per year, and the prevalence is estimated at 240,000 cases. Post-stroke depression (PSD) affects approximately one third of patients after ischemic stroke and significantly affects rehabilitation and quality of life. The aim of our work was to determine the frequency of PSD after the first ischemic stroke in our department and to evaluate the interest of patients in drug and experimental treatments. Methodology: The study included patients hospitalized after the first ischemic stroke without previous depression and aphasia. Depression screening was performed using the Beck Depression Inventory (BDI-II) first after 3 months in the outpatient clinic, and later during hospitalization after protocol modification. Results: 40 patients were examined in the outpatient phase, out of whom 12 (30%) were depressed. Only 3 patients agreed to a psychiatric examination. After the protocol change, 300 patients were examined during hospitalization, 51 (17%) were screened as depressed, and 43 patients (14.3%) were treated with antidepressants. Conclusions: The prevalence of PSD reached 17-30% depending on the timing of screening. A fundamental problem is the low compliance of patients with psychiatric care due to stigmatization. Screening during hospitalization appears to be more practical than outpatient monitoring.
Aim: Hemangioblastomas are benign, highly vascular tumors that originate within the central nervous system. Histologically, these tumors are composed of stromal cells embedded in a dense network of blood vessels. The aim of the study was to present our surgical outcomes in sporadic cerebellar hemangioblastomas and to investigate the relationship between the cystic component size and the presence of hydrocephalus and associated clinical findings. Materials and methods: We retrospectively reviewed 29 adult patients with sporadic cerebellar hemangioblastomas operated by a single surgeon between 2010 and 2022. Tumors were classified as solid, small cystic (< 2.5 cm), or large cystic (>= 2.5 cm). Clinical, imaging, and surgical data were analyzed, and functional outcomes were measured using the modified Rankin Scale (mRS) and Karnofsky Performance Scale (KPS) scores. The relationship between cyst size, hydrocephalus, and neurological outcome was also examined. Results: Larger cysts were significantly linked to hydrocephalus (P = 0.038) and cerebellar symptoms (P = 0.026). Regression suggested a possible association between cyst size and these findings (P = 0.062 and P = 0.053). Cyst and nodule sizes showed moderate correlation (r = 0.520; P = 0.013). Cysts were also larger in patients needing an external ventricular drain (41,00 vs. 28,78 mm; P = 0.053). No significant differences were found between groups in mRS or KPS scores before and 1 year after surgery (P > 0.6). Conclusion: Hemangioblastomas are benign, but their posterior fossa location often causes significant symptoms. En bloc resection of the nodule with wide craniotomy remains the best treatment. This study highlights the link between large cysts and hydrocephalus, suggesting early surgery may improve outcomes.
Background and objectives: The eligibility of acute ischemic stroke (AIS) patients with pre-existing neurological disability (modified Rankin Scale [mRS] >= 3) for acute reperfusion therapy remains uncertain. The aim was to identify factors predicting the return to their baseline functional status after reperfusion therapy in AIS patients with premorbid disability (pre-stroke mRS >= 3). Methods: We analyzed data from patients with premorbid disability from the Czech national registry for intravenous thrombolysis/endovascular treatment (2016-2020). The primary outcome was return to baseline mRS (Delta mRS = 0) at 3 months. Using multivariate logistic regression, we identified predictors of this outcome. Results: Among 1,712 patients, 32.1% (275/ 857) returned to their baseline status. Independent predictors of successful return included: age (adjusted odds ratio [aOR] 0.97 per year, 95% confidence interval [CI] 0.95-0.98), baseline National Institutes of Health Stroke Scale (NIHSS) (aOR 0.94 per point, 95% CI 0.92-0.96), absence of atrial fibrillation (aOR 0.78, 95% CI 0.63-0.97), and onset-to-treatment time (aOR 0.99 per minute, 95% CI 0.98-0.99). Patients with premorbid mRS 3 were more likely to return to baseline than those with an mRS 4-5 (aOR 1.42, 95% CI 1.18-1.67). Reperfusion was more effective in patients with atherothrombotic stroke etiology (aOR 1.69, 95% CI 1.31-2.14) compared to cardioembolic etiology (aOR 1.21, 95% CI 0.95-1.53). Discussion: Younger age, lower NIHSS, absence of atrial fibrillation, atherothrombotic etiology, and faster treatment commencement are key predictors of regaining baseline functional status after reperfusion in AIS patients with premorbid disability.
The Department of Psychiatry and Neurology of the German Charles University in Prague was among the leading medical institutions in Central Europe in the early 20th century. In October 1939, Professor Kurt Albrecht, a Berlin neurologist and member of both the NSDAP and the SS, was appointed head of the department. During his tenure, he secured a separate building for the neurological section and held senior academic positions, including dean of the medical faculty, and finally, he even became the last rector of the German Charles University. Albrecht's death at the end of the Second World War remains a mystery. Contemporary accounts differ, some attributing it to suicide, and others to his death in armed resistance. While his career is inseparably linked with the Nazi regime, he remains part of the lineage of chiefs of the department, which history forms a broader professional tradition beyond political entanglements. In re-examining the circumstances of his death, we combined established sources with newly identified unpublished archival material from Prague and Berlin, as well as testimonies of contemporaries from German University circles in Prague. These findings contribute to a more nuanced portrait of Albrecht and his era, inviting interpretations that extend beyond narrow national frameworks or the postwar perspective.
Background: Hypertensive cerebral hemorrhage is a common cerebrovascular disease. Aim: This study aimed to assess the effects of whole-course case management in combination with mind mapping on the neurological functions and prognosis of patients receiving hematoma evacuation for hypertensive cerebral hemorrhage. Methods: A total of 130 patients who underwent hematoma evacuation for hypertensive cerebral hemorrhage were retrospectively included and assigned into a case group (N = 66, given whole-course case management plus mind mapping) and a conventional group (N = 64, given conventional nursing). Neurological functions, activities of daily living, exercise ability, blood pressures, mental state, and complications were compared between the two groups. Categorical variables were expressed as absolute numbers and percentages, and compared between groups using the Chi-square test. Normally distributed data were expressed as (mean +/- standard deviation) and subjected to the t-test. Results: After intervention, both groups showed significant improvements in Fugl-Meyer Assessment scores, with the case group demonstrating significantly higher scores than the conventional group (P < 0.05). The positive affect score significantly increased, whereas the negative affect score significantly decreased in both groups, and the case group displayed significant increases in the positive affect score and reductions in the negative affect score in comparison to the conventional group (P < 0.05). The total incidence rate of complications was significantly lower in the case group than in the conventional group (7.58 vs. 21.88%; P < 0.05). Conclusion: The nursing model combining whole-course case management with mind mapping is capable of boosting the recovery of neurological functions, enhancing the activities of daily living and exercise ability, and stabilizing the blood pressure in patients with hypertensive cerebral hemorrhage receiving hematoma evacuation.
Background: Acute ischemic stroke (AIS) patients tend to have rapid disease progression, with collateral circulation gradually failing over time. Aim: We aimed to investigate the preoperative collateral circulation state in AIS patients undergoing mechanical thrombectomy and its association with clinical prognosis. Methods: Subjects (N = 112) were recruited from AIS patients receiving mechanical thrombectomy during January 2019 and December 2022. The preoperative collateral circulation state in ischemic regions was assessed. Analyses were carried out on different occlusion sites and potential compensation pathways of collateral circulation. Results: Subjects presenting poor preoperative collateral circulation had a significantly raised prognostic modified Rankin Scale (mRS) score compared with those exhibiting good preoperative collateral circulation (P < 0.05). The preoperative collateral circulation state displayed a significantly positive correlation with prognosis (r = 0.834; P < 0.05). The baseline National Institutes of Health Stroke Scale score, time from admission to recanalization, modified Thrombolysis in Cerebral Infarction score, and preoperative collateral circulation state were risk factors in terms of prognosis (P < 0.05). Sensitivity, area under the curve, and specificity of preoperative collateral circulatory state for predicting the prognosis reached 89.60%, 0.879 (95% CI = 0.800-0.945), and 86.53%, respectively. Conclusion: Collateral circulation before mechanical thrombectomy has a significant relationship to AIS patients' prognosis, and a poor one serves as a risk factor independently influencing the prognosis.
Aim: To propose a methodology for the early diagnosis of tuberous sclerosis complex (TSC) based on an evaluation of a prospectively monitored cohort of children diagnosed with cardiac rhabdomyoma (CR). Methods: Diagnosis of TSC is both genetic and clinical, based on the presence of 11 major and 7 minor clinical criteria. At least two major features are required to confirm the diagnosis. The earliest major feature is prenatal detection of CR, while additional major features may be identified on brain MRI. Between 2019 and 2024, 17 children with a prenatal or perinatal finding of CR were monitored at the Department of Pediatric Neurology and the Children's Heart Centre of the Motol University Hospital. All patients underwent fetal or early postnatal echocardiography and brain MRI, with regular EEG monitoring. The children were followed from the neonatal period with the aim of diagnosing TSC and epilepsy. Results: A diagnosis of TSC was confirmed in 14 out of 17 children (83%) monitored for CR. Epilepsy manifested in 13 of the 14 TSC patients (93%), with 10 of these 13 cases occurring within the first six months of life. A care protocol for patients with prenatal or perinatal findings of CR and a recommended approach for early TSC diagnosis have been summarized in several key points. Conclusion: Examination of the fetus or newborn with CR is critical for the early diagnosis of TSC and epilepsy, enabling risk reduction for the development of epileptic encephalopathy. We propose a diagnostic methodology for TSC in the context of a prenatal or perinatal finding of CR.
Introduction: Chronic subdural hematoma (CSDH) is almost the most frequent neurosurgical diagnosis. In particular, with an aging population and the use of antiplatelet and anticoagulant therapy, these cases are on the rise. Surgical treatment, usually managed by simple burr-hole evacuation is a relatively simple and effective method of treatment. Despite the successful primary surgery, there is an increase in CSDH recurrence. Recently, minimally invasive procedures have become a trend. Endovascular embolization of the middle meningeal artery (MMA) is a relatively new and now in the world frequently used therapeutic modality. Methods: We present a series of patients treated with MMA embolization with or without trepanation. Results: Our cohort includes forty patients with CSDH-recurrent and primary. In 97.5% patients, we achieved complete resolution of CSDH after MMA embolization, one patient was re-hospitalized for another recurrence despite embolization. In three patients, MMA embolization was used as a primary and single treatment for CSDH. Conclusion: MMA embolization can be used as a single or additional treatment for CSDH recurrence. It can also be used in patients who are not suitable candidates for trepanation due to other comorbidities. MMA embolization appears to be a safe and relatively simple management of recurrences of CSDH, when the rules of endovascular treatment are followed.
